The following is the 2011 postal holiday schedule in the U.S.:
• Saturday, January 1 – New Year’s Day
• Monday, January 17 – MLK Jr. Day
• Monday, February 21 – President’s Day
• Monday, May 30 – Memorial Day
• Monday, July 4 – Independence Day
• Monday, September 5 – Labor Day
• Monday, October 10 – Columbus Day
• Friday, November 11 – Veterans Day
• Thursday, November 24 – Thanksgiving Day
• Monday, December 26 – Christmas Day (observed)
• Monday, January 2, 2012 – New Year’s Day (observed)
On Christmas Eve and New Year’s Eve, many post offices will hold holiday shortened hours by closing at noon.
